
Prior to joining the Law Office of Benjamin Kanani, Ms. Desmond practiced as a criminal defense attorney at the Law Office of Robert L. Shapiro, where she represented clients in high-profile misdemeanor and felony matters in both State and Federal Court. Directly working with internationally renowned litigator Robert Shapiro, Ms. Desmond’s first trial was a murder case which made headlines and was featured on Dateline NBC and the CBS investigative television show, 48 Hours.
After several years in criminal court, Virginia was inspired to transition into family law, where her trial experience and knowledge of high-stakes litigation made her an ideal fit. While participating in the Harriet Buhai Center’s Family Law Intensive Program (“FLIP”), where she volunteered her time to help low–income individuals seeking domestic violence and family law assistance, Ms. Desmond developed a passion for helping families find a peaceful resolution to their disputes during emotionally difficult and trying times.
Upon completion of the FLIP program, Ms. Desmond decided to transition fully into family law and began practicing in the Greater Los Angeles Area, taking on clients in her own private practice for referrals that began coming in immediately from friends, family and colleagues that were looking for help. Ms. Desmond received a Bachelor of Arts degree in Women’s Studies from the University of California, Los Angeles and obtained her law degree in 2012 from Loyola Law School in Los Angeles, California. She is also an active member of the Beverly Hills Bar Association and the Los Angeles County Bar Association.
